The midnight temperature maximum from Arecibo incoherent scatter radar ion temperature measurements

The midnight temperature maximum (MTM) is studied using ion temperature data from the incoherent scatter radar at the Arecibo Observatory (18.31N, 66.21W). The MTM is characterized by fitting the radar data with a function that takes into account diurnal, semidiurnal and terdiurnal components. Total Ionospheric Electron Content Calibration Using SERIES GPS Satellite Data

This article describes the current status of the Deep Space Network advanced systems research into ionospheric calibration techniques, based on Global Positioning System (GPS) data. A GPS-based calibration system is planned to replace the currently used Faraday rotation method by 1989. Variations of electron density based on long-term incoherent scatter radar and ionosonde measurements over Millstone Hill

[1] Measurements from the incoherent scatter radar (ISR) and ionosonde over Millstone Hill (42.6 N, 288.5 E) are analyzed to explore ionospheric temporal variations. The F2 layer peak density NmF2, peak height hmF2, and scale height H are derived from a Chapman a layer fitting to observed ISR electron density profiles. Statistical analysis on spatial correlation of ionospheric day-to-day variability by using GPS and Incoherent Scatter Radar observations

In this paper, the spatial correlations of ionospheric day-to-day variability are investigated by statistical analysis on GPS and Incoherent Scatter Radar observations. The meridional correlations show significant (>0.8) correlations in the latitudinal blocks of about 6 degrees size on average.
